    Comparative study of chiro- and photo-optical properties of three novel chiral photochromic liquid crystalline azobenzene-containing comb-shaped polyacrylates was performed. The synthesized polymers contain the same polyacrylate backbones and uniform in spacer size but have different structure of azobenzene-containing mesogenic groups with different chiral tail. Existence of lateral chlorine substituent in the mesogen fragment leads to an extreme decrease of isotropization temperature and causes a disappearance of cholesteric mesophase. Circular dichroism (CD) spectra demonstrate a formation of helical order elements even in the amorphousized spin-coated polymer films. Possibility of manipulation of CD values and degree of a helical order by light and annealing was studied. UV-irradiation of all polymers induces E-Z isomerization of azobenzene groups disrupting LC-order.
